Abstract (EN)

The mechanical behavior of the adhesives used in bonding joints has recently gained importance. In this study, a double-acting overlap was created without any epoxy adhesive additives, tensile and bending strengths were made on the connections, lowering lengths of 10, 20, 30 mm, radius length of 5, 10, 15 mm and layer thickness of 0.5, 1 and 1.5 mm experimental studies were carried out. In the experimental studies, DP460 epoxy adhesive and AL5754 Aluminum plate were used as the adhered material. As a result of the experiments, it was observed that the damage load and elongation amount of the samples increased as the layer thickness increased. It has also been observed that the increase in the bending radius length affects the damage load and the amount of elongation of the samples.
